LEAD WITH IMPACT: A WORKSHOP FOR NEW DIRECTORS
Dates: July 6–8, 2026 (starting July 8 at 1:00 PM – ending July 8 at 4:00 PM) Location: Nightingale Bamford School, 20 E 92nd St, New York, NY 10128 Cost: $1,295 (IGL members) / $1,495 (non-members); Group dinner on Monday, July 6, and lunches on Tuesday, July 7, and Wednesday, July 8 included Description: A hallmark of the Institute for Global Learning community, this three-day institute supports new and early-career administrators overseeing global education and off-campus experiential programs. Using the Institute for Global Learning’s Global Education Standards, the program offers guidance in mission and vision, governance, competency-based curriculum, faculty leader oversight, program management, communication strategies, and risk management. Participants join a supportive cohort of peers with similar roles and challenges and receive ongoing follow-up through two virtual sessions over the course of the year. Each participant receives the Updated Annotated Guide to Global Education.
Key Areas of Leadership & Oversight:
- Program mission and vision
- Governance of off-campus programs
- Competency-based curriculum across disciplines and ages
- Communication with diverse stakeholders
- Program management, budgeting, and logistics
- Recruiting and overseeing faculty leaders
- Risk management for overnight programs
